O LORD, how manifold are thy works! in wisdom hast thou made them all: the earth is full of thy riches.
O LORD, how countless are your works! You have made them all with wisdom: the earth is full of your treasures.
The writer is marveling at the incredible variety and wisdom displayed in everything God has created, recognizing that the earth overflows with God's good gifts.
📚 Historical Context
This psalm is a creation hymn that celebrates God's work in making and sustaining the natural world. The psalmist would have been writing from an agrarian society that depended closely on nature's rhythms and saw God's hand directly in the cycles of weather, seasons, and wildlife. This verse comes near the end of a detailed poetic description of God's creative acts, from the heavens to the sea creatures.
